MoPdN3 is an experimental intermetallic nitride compound combining molybdenum, palladium, and nitrogen. This material belongs to the family of refractory metal nitrides and represents research-stage work into high-performance materials for extreme environments. The palladium-molybdenum combination suggests potential applications requiring corrosion resistance, high-temperature stability, and wear resistance, though this specific composition is not yet established in commercial engineering practice.
